Last month Tory Lanez dropped the single “F.E.E.LS” featuring Chris Brown, from his upcoming R&B capsule, Playboy. The following week the capsule’s cover art and a release date of March 5th, was announced. 

Using all-caps as he’s warrant to do, Tory declared, “HERE IT IS […] THE COVER OF THE RNB CAPSULE, ENTITLED “PLAYBOY.” THIS WILL DROP [ON] MARCH 5.”

While Tory’s project was previously-announced, Drake’s EP comes as a surprise to fans. His album Certified Lover Boy was initially set to release back in January but Drizzy announced on his Instagram story it would be delayed.

“I was planning to release my album this month, but between surgery and rehab, my energy has been dedicated to recovery. I’m blessed to be back on my feet, feeling great and focused on the album, but CLB won’t be dropping in January. I’m looking forward to sharing it with you all in 2021,” Drake wrote on his Instagram story.

The latest update on CLB comes from blogger DJ Akademiks, who previously reported CLB would be dropping before, or during, the month of April.  The blogger added Drizzy is working “overtime on creating this next masterpiece.”
